Warning about deep hole causing rip current at Cornish beach
Published by Sarah Yeoman at 8:06am 17th July 2020.
A warning has gone out about a strong current at a west Cornwall beach.
The RNLI says there is currently a deep hole in front of the lifeguard unit at Mexico Towans, in Hayle.
At mid to high tide this is causing a strong rip current in the areas. read more »

Information needed to find the missing (Herbert Protocol)
The Herbert Protocol encourages carers or family members of adults living with dementia to collate information on those who are vulnerable onto a form, know as the Herbert Protocol form, that can be given to the police if they go missing.

PA20/05161 | Reserved Matters application for the construction of 377 residential units; 598 sqm retail (Class A1-A5 and sui generis floorspace; 2,407 sqm of business (Class B1) and industrial and fish storage (Class B2 and B8) floorspace; a 4,409 sqm hotel (Class C1); 2,275 sqm of community and cultural (Class D1) floorpsace and sports and leisure (Class D2) floorspace; and associated access, parking and public open space. The original Outline consent (W1/08-0613) was an environment impact assessment application and an environmental statement was submitted to Cornwall Council at that time. (Details following application no. pursuant to Outline permission PA13/01370). read more »

Work under way for new spine road at North Quay
11 June 2020
An environmental initiative is under way to monitor and protect local wildlife as part of the latest phase in the regeneration of Hayle Harbour.
Environmentalists and ecologists are working alongside the construction team at the site of the North Quay development as preparations are made for a new spine road as part of the transformation of the area into an exciting and vibrant new coastal destination for West Cornwall. read more »
